ScyllaDB
E724173
ScyllaDB is a high-performance, distributed NoSQL database designed as a drop-in replacement for Apache Cassandra, optimized for low latency and high throughput.
Observed surface forms (2)
| Surface form | Occurrences |
|---|---|
| ScyllaDB NoSQL database | 1 |
| TSDB | 1 |
Statements (91)
| Predicate | Object |
|---|---|
| instanceOf |
Cassandra-compatible database
ⓘ
NoSQL database ⓘ distributed database ⓘ |
| AlternatorCompatibility | Amazon DynamoDB API NERFINISHED ⓘ |
| architecture |
sharded per-core architecture
ⓘ
shared-nothing ⓘ |
| basedOn | Seastar framework NERFINISHED ⓘ |
| compatibleWith | Apache Cassandra NERFINISHED ⓘ |
| consistencyModel | tunable consistency per operation ⓘ |
| dataModel | partition key and clustering key-based tables ⓘ |
| developer | ScyllaDB Inc. NERFINISHED ⓘ |
| dropInReplacementFor | Apache Cassandra NERFINISHED ⓘ |
| faultTolerance |
multi-datacenter replication
ⓘ
rack-aware placement ⓘ replication across nodes ⓘ |
| feature |
REST-based management API
ⓘ
auto-tuning caching ⓘ auto-tuning compaction ⓘ automatic hinting ⓘ backpressure mechanisms ⓘ data center-aware replication ⓘ online scaling ⓘ rack-aware replication ⓘ repair-based node operations ⓘ rolling upgrades ⓘ web-based management console ⓘ workload shedding ⓘ |
| hasComponent |
Scylla Alternator
NERFINISHED
ⓘ
Scylla Manager NERFINISHED ⓘ Scylla Monitoring Stack NERFINISHED ⓘ |
| hasEdition |
Scylla Cloud
NERFINISHED
ⓘ
Scylla Enterprise NERFINISHED ⓘ Scylla Open Source NERFINISHED ⓘ |
| license | AGPLv3 (core) ⓘ |
| optimizedFor |
high availability
ⓘ
high throughput ⓘ horizontal scalability ⓘ low latency ⓘ |
| programmingLanguage | C++ ⓘ |
| supports |
Apache Cassandra drivers
ⓘ
CQL NERFINISHED ⓘ Cassandra Query Language NERFINISHED ⓘ Docker deployment ⓘ DynamoDB-compatible API via Alternator ⓘ Grafana dashboards ⓘ I/O scheduling ⓘ Kubernetes deployment ⓘ Prometheus metrics ⓘ Raft-based schema management ⓘ SSTable format (Cassandra-compatible) ⓘ automatic load balancing ⓘ automatic sharding ⓘ change data capture ⓘ cloud deployment ⓘ encryption at rest ⓘ encryption in transit ⓘ eventual consistency ⓘ incremental repair ⓘ lightweight transactions ⓘ materialized views ⓘ multi-datacenter replication ⓘ multi-tenant resource isolation ⓘ on-premises deployment ⓘ row-level TTL ⓘ row-level repair ⓘ secondary indexes ⓘ strong consistency (per operation via consistency levels) ⓘ tunable consistency ⓘ workload prioritization ⓘ |
| supportsAPI |
Cassandra native protocol
ⓘ
Thrift (legacy, via compatibility) ⓘ |
| supportsDeployment |
AWS
NERFINISHED
ⓘ
Google Cloud Platform NERFINISHED ⓘ Microsoft Azure NERFINISHED ⓘ bare metal servers ⓘ virtual machines ⓘ |
| supportsLanguageClient |
C#
NERFINISHED
ⓘ
C++ NERFINISHED ⓘ Go NERFINISHED ⓘ Java NERFINISHED ⓘ Node.js NERFINISHED ⓘ Python NERFINISHED ⓘ Ruby NERFINISHED ⓘ |
| targetUser | large-scale, latency-sensitive applications ⓘ |
| useCase |
IoT data
ⓘ
fraud detection ⓘ real-time analytics ⓘ recommendation systems ⓘ time-series data ⓘ user activity tracking ⓘ |
| writtenIn | C++ NERFINISHED ⓘ |
Referenced by (5)
Full triples — surface form annotated when it differs from this entity's canonical label.
this entity surface form:
ScyllaDB NoSQL database